            • Interview with protesters at a joint Occupy Wall Street/labor union rally in New York City, Oct. 5, 2011, conducted by Melinda Tuhus <!--break--> Voices of the 99 Percent Interview with protesters at a joint Occupy Wall Street/labor union rally in New York City, Oct. 5, 2011, conducted by Melinda Tuhus Less than a month old, the new Occupy Wall Street protests, spreading like wildfire across the U.S., have already had a profound effect on the national debate, which up until a few weeks ago centered in Washington around budget cuts and slashing social safety net programs like Social Security, Medicare and Medicaid. With its newfound power to influence, the direct action movement has attracted new allies in labor unions that have made common cause with the protesters’ grievances against Wall Street greed and political corruption.
